This course explores the emotional dimensions of driver cessation, addressing the complex feelings of loss, anxiety, and the change in identity that often accompany the transition. The presentation will look into the psychological impact of relinquishing driving privileges, including the potential for increased social isolation and diminished independence. We will also learn about resources currently available to older drivers with a focus on how family members can sensitively approach a conversation about discontinuing driving with an older family member or loved one.
The goal is to 
equip caregivers, family members, and professionals with the tools to support older adults through this challenging life change.
